Are there specific instructors/courses that had a critical impact? 

Portfolio Theory & Application taught by Professor Perry was the most impactful for me during the program. This class allowed me to be an analyst for the Haley Large Cap Fund, a student-run portfolio that is managed by the MSF class for either the fall and/or spring semester. I was able to find a passion within equity research, as this class gave me the opportunities to research stocks within my industry, perform quantitative and qualitative analyses, present stock pitches, and stay up to date with current events through CIO presentations.
